ENERCON's Nuclear Design Group is a leader in the nuclear power industry, providing comprehensive engineering, licensing, and environmental services to support nuclear power plants worldwide. We offer a full range of services, including designing plant modifications, safety analysis, licensing renewals, and advanced reactor support, with a commitment to delivering high-quality, efficient, and cost-effective solutions. Our extensive experience includes Engineer of Choice contracts at over 90% of U.S. nuclear plants and numerous evolving projects.

We maintain rigorous quality assurance standards and are recognized for our responsive service and innovation in addressing the challenges of new and existing nuclear facilities.

What are skills that would be helpful to your success as a new graduate?
  • Graduated with a bachelor's or master's degree from an ABET- accredited school in one of our listed preferred majors.
  • Available to start on an agreed upon date between January 2026 and July 2027.
  • Preferred Courses:
    Thermodynamics, Fluid Mechanics, Heat Transfer, Material Science, and Statics.
  • A solid working foundation with your major's core concepts.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Suite.
  • Excellent writing, presentation, and communication skills.
  • Ability to be an individual contributor and work effectively in teams.
  • Ability to effectively problem solve.
  • Must be able to climb stairs and ladders at client sites.
  • Must be able to effectively navigate client sites to conduct walkdowns.
  • Must be able to work outside.
  • Ability and willingness to travel for client and company projects and/or meetings.
